Spring Migration has arrived!
For anyone on the forums that may be interestd in the bird side of wildlife, spring migration is hitting the gulf coast already and interest is rising at places like High Island Sanctuary (as mentioned in the movie / book The Big Year). The peak for warbler movement is less than 3 weeks away, with typical arrivals starting to fall out on the coast around April 15th - May 1st. Last year my record day was 28 Warbler species (This is not maggie marsh in Ohio, so it's a VERY solid number for Texas!)
